Abstract
The variable gain amplifier includes a parallel connection of resistance R2 and capacitor C2. Resistance R2 may be replaced by inductance L, and bipolar transistors may be replaced by other types such MOS transistors. Resistance R2 gives a current feedback for transistor Q2, thereby lowering the mutual conductance “gm” of transistor Q2, and limiting the current flowing from voltage supply V0. The emitter area ratio (the emitter area of transistor Q2: the emitter area of Q3) made to be 1: n where “n” is greater than or equal to 1, thereby controlling each current. Capacitor C2 is connected in parallel with R2 connected with the base of transistor Q2 is a bypass capacitor for lowering the impedance of the base of transistor Q2 in higher frequency range. Capacitor C2 is a peaking capacitor, because it improves the high frequency characteristics.
